Senior Member ADil Posted March 30, 2021 Senior Member Share Posted March 30, 2021 Hi Pre surgery:- Finally after a month delay (acidity problems ..stress lead to acidity let to stress.. vicious cycle) I got my hair transplant done at Eugenix lead by Dr Priyadarshini and the amazing Mumbai team on 24 March 2021 The hairline was designed conservatively with both Doc and i agreeing to make it V shaped. My temples even though had receeded still had some hair so they were also filled. Surgery experience :- Final grafts :-2612 Surgery started at 1030 am and went on to 10 pm.. Dr Priyadarshini did all the initial slits for the implantation as is the practice at Eugenix and was present during all crucial extraction/implantation. As I had a lot of superficial nerves , the bleeding was a bit much which slowed the process quite a lot. But Dr Priyadarshini and the team were very through , precise and worked very hard. Post surgery:- I was given a kit with saline spray and a chart for precautions/medications Dr. is just a whatsapp away for any queries This forum and my research has equipped me with the knowledge of what to expect on the first 7 days and beyond.. Day 0-7 Sleeping on the back was a major issue. Didnt sleep for more than 2 hours at a time in all 7 days Pro tip :- Tied my wrists to my ankles so that i don't scratch my grafts in sleep ( read somewhere on this forum ) Slight itching sensations but was advised more frequent saline sprays and one SOS medicine. Day 10 update All crusts and scabs finally came off.. Took 4 washes in 4 days. Went to Eugenix clinic for three washes. They were very gentle and through. A bit of redness is there on the transplanted area but it should go eventually. The Donor area is healing pretty well too. All the transplanted hairs ( eventually will fall off in the shedding phase ) have sprouted. Hair at Temple points do concern me as they are very very light. I am told i had a lot of baby hairs at temple points originally. Hopefully they should fill up in the coming months.(wow its gonna take months.. ) I am starting Hair Fact multi vitamins recommended by doc from tomorrow ie. 5 April. I am on Finastiride since the beginning and maybe will start minoxidil from next month. Right now I am in my "yay ..i have a hairline phase. Senior Member ADil Posted April 22, 2021 Author Senior Member Share Posted April 22, 2021 1 month Update 29days - Shedding has fully begun. I see lots of hair in the shower and a few during the day. - Temple area has been sparse and have very few hairs. Hopefully the tiny original hair grows to cover it along with the newly transplanted ones. - There is still numbness in the front hair area which occasionally itches. - Donor area has healed pretty well and hair till now has covered 85% of the scars. - Not liking how I look at all. Looking really old and worse. The next few months will be tough. - Hair fact multivitamins and Finpecia 1mg daily routine. - Mildly daily shampoo and Ketostar weekly. 4 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
